繁体   English   中英

当我使用我的IP地址而不是localhost作为URL时出错

[英]error when i used my ip address instead of localhost as URL

我已经下载了WAMP服务器,我编写了一个非常简单的PHP代码并将其保存

C:\\ WAMP \\ WWW \\ php_lear

夹。 我用chrome给出了url测试它

{本地主机/ php_lear / eg2.php}

它工作得很好。 这使用存储在phpmyadmin中的数据库。 我从谷歌117.195.230.41找到了我的IP地址。 当我给

{} 117.195.230.41/php_lear/eg2.php

作为URL它给我404找不到

“在此服务器上找不到请求的网址'/php_lear/eg2.php'”

请帮忙。 我不知道ips和urls,对这个领域很新,是的,我已经在phpmyadmin中添加了这个ip作为允许的用户。 我实际上想在我的Android应用程序中使用它。

您从谷歌获得的IP地址是路由器的IP地址。 它没有指向您的计算机。 正如一些人说的那样,除了在连接中使用不同的端口,你的WAMP安装在计算机的端口80上“监听”(127.0.0.1)

当您访问117.195.230.41时,您将访问Internet服务提供商为您的安装提供的IP。 因此,您需要访问路由器并将所有查询重定向到端口80上的117.195.230.41到您的端口80以及本地网络中计算机的IP。

公共/私人知识产权混淆是一种常见的误解。

迈克是对的。 由于IP寻址的工作原理,地址数量有限。 结果,网络地址转换诞生了(其他无关紧要的事情)。 公共知识产权是世界在看到您的流量时所看到的。 您需要您的专用IP,即路由器的DHCP为您提供的IP。

1)打开命令提示符。

2)发出命令“ipconfig”(不带引号)。

3)找到您的“IPv4地址”。 这就是你想要的那个。

此外,请遵循Surt的建议,让一切正常运作。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M